Dudishal

Gilgit-BaltistanRock ArtProtected
About one km from the suspension bridge west of the Nullah a steep rock face is rising from a narrow sandy terrace, where prehistoric rock carvings and later period were found. On the face of the rock a carving of a Bronze Age giant was supper imposed by later renderings of a building, ten horsemen, and five animals and dancing group were also found.
